Man Found Dead After Leaving Note at Stranded Car in Desert
By TheNevadaGlobeStaff, September 10, 2024 11:55 am
Las Vegas, Nevada – A man was found deceased in the Nevada desert after leaving a note at his stranded vehicle.
The Nye County Sheriff’s Office (NCSO) responded to the incident on Monday, which occurred between Hafen Ranch Road and the Pahrump Valley Highway.
After discovering the abandoned car, deputies attempted to locate the driver and requested assistance from Search and Rescue. The Las Vegas Metropolitan Police Department provided aerial support with a helicopter.
A note left at the vehicle indicated that the man was walking towards NV-160. Approximately two hours later, he was found deceased about a quarter-mile away from the car.
Metro’s air unit recovered the body, which was then transferred to Nye County officials. The Southern Nevada Off-Road Recovery team also retrieved the stranded vehicle and brought it to a paved area.
The circumstances surrounding the man’s death are currently under investigation by the Nye County Sheriff’s Office.
